    Frequently Asked Questions about Career Success

    Career success is that confident feeling you get when you are doing work that you enjoy, you are making money, and you're appreciated and recognized for your professional contributions. When you find that these achievements come together in unison in a positive way, that's generally seen as career success.

    The levels of career success may vary with different people. A younger 20-something worker may just be happy to earn a decent salary while overseeing some work responsibilities and being able to pay the bills. An older worker, with years of experience and job responsibilities, may see career success differently, yearning for a financial windfall or the top title at a company.‎

    Learning about career success can help you define a clear path for you in your personal life and your work life. The clearer your definition is of career success, then the more inspired you will be to do the work that makes you happy.

    You may eventually learn that career success is more than just earning money and getting a larger company title. You may seek inner peace, a satisfaction for your soul. For instance, your work may look great to outsiders looking in, but inside, you may feel unfulfilled and possibly miserable with your career work. As you go through your career, you will start to see how these feelings play out in your life.‎

    You can move forward to other fulfilling and rewarding career opportunities from learning the insights of career success. Once you have a firm understanding of what career success means to you, then you will be able to take what you've learned and apply it in more meaningful ways in your life.

    For example, you may be working as a project manager for a tech firm, earning a fair salary and working regularly. But if it is unfulfilling work to you, and you seek more meaningful work, you may learn that moving your career into nonprofit work or other altruistic areas may make a big difference in your overall happiness levels.‎
